  <description>GNext is a reusable foundation for building graph-based AI applications from complex multimodal data. In this first release, the Graph AI team from Fujitsu Research of Europe’s AI Lab introduces how GNext connects graph construction, learning, analytics, explainability, provenance, and contribution workflows through a shared GraphIR representation, with example applications in satellite intelligence, personalised medicine, and financial fraud detection. The team is inviting contributors and early adopters to try GNext.</description>
